Hey, what does this one do?

This is a simple plugin, that allows you to see the damage done to an entity via pop-up.

ShowDamage have a highly configurable config, so any colors, icons or visibility settings can be changed.

Commands

  • /showdamage toggle-popup: Toggles a pop-up visibility for you.

    Requires permission: "showdamage.command.disablepopup"

  • /showdamage reload-config: Reloads the configuration.

    Requires permission: "showdamage.command.reloadconfig"

Config entries

messages:
  - hotbar-messages: (true/false) Should hotbar projetile damage be visible?
  - chat-messages: (true/false) Should chat projectile damage messages be visible?

display-settings:
  - popup-background-transparency: (0-255) Sets the alpha value of the popup background color, or how transparent it should be. 0 = fully transparent, 255 = black.
  - popup-lifetime-ticks: Pretty self-explanatory. Defines how many ticks (20 ticks - 1 second) a popup should be visible.
  - popup-visibility-distance: The radius from the entity to the player at which it becomes invisible.
  - popup-additional-height: Additional pop-up position height. By default, pop-up spawn location is 0.15 above entity.
  - count-multiple-entities: Should the plugin combine direct attacks and sweeping sword attacks in a single hit span?
  - multiple-entities-count-distance: The range within which the plugin can link attacks with a sword swing.
  - projectile-message-distance: The distance at which messages about hits from a bow, snowball, trident, or other projectile begin to appear in the chat and hotbar.
  - allow-toggle-command: Should the plugin allow players to disable pop-ups locally?
  - show-to-damage-source-only: Should the plugin display pop-ups only to the attacker?
  - show-damage-as-hearts: Enables hearts mode. Displays damage as full HP (big heart) and half HP (small heart).
  - show-through-walls: Should the damage be visible thru the blocks?
  - filter-non-living-entities: Should the plugin also show damage dealt to End Crystals, Armor Stands* etc.?

colors: 
  - crit-damage:
    - first: First color of the gradient, stored in HEX, without a '#' (like BE2510)
    - second: Second color of the gradient, stored in HEX, without a '#' (like FD7348)
  - mitigated-damage: Basically a blocked damage that shows above your hotbar when you are hit.
    - first: First color of the gradient.
    - second: Second color of the gradient.
    - icon: An icon that will be displayed left to the damage. Can be empty.
  - message:
    - first: Color of the message text. Default one is green (`25af46`)
    - second: Color of the 'i' sign. 
    - elements: Color of `Entity` name and `DAMAGE HP` text.

prefixes:
  - show-attack-prefixes: (true/false) Should the prefixes (crit sign, sweep, explosion, mace, projectile, trident etc.) be visible at all.
  - crit-prefix: A symbol or a string that applies to the damage if it was critical.
  - sweep, explosion, mace, projectile, trident, spear: should be pretty self-explanatory.
